Transaction 95bb21817249cf9829b65b419fd63be8e06dc4887b50c7b0e19fb53fb63f8043

1 Input
2 Outputs
  • 95bb21817249cf9829b65b419fd63be8e06dc4887b50c7b0e19fb53fb63f8043:0
  • value  20664
    address  12ZyTeF954uMyoCXFZWf2dEBoydu7wkuza
  • 95bb21817249cf9829b65b419fd63be8e06dc4887b50c7b0e19fb53fb63f8043:1
  • value  4296171
    address  1M9pRAmBEYfRGxxpYtJUAZgsjsnfD7tHhZ